What does it take to truly tune into yourself and trust your inner voice?

In this episode, I sit down with Katie Leasor—a certified yoga therapist, sound healing practitioner in training, and former college athlete turned mindfulness advocate. We dive into the transformative power of slowing down, reconnecting with your body, and embracing the healing journey that begins within.

Katie opens up about her personal story of overcoming emotional challenges, finding inner peace, and transforming pain into purpose through yoga therapy and somatic healing. We unpack what makes yoga therapy so unique, why tuning into your body’s cues is crucial, and how community plays an often-overlooked role in the healing process. Whether you’re curious about yoga, searching for balance, or navigating your own self-discovery, this episode will inspire you to see that healing is possible—and it starts with you.

Topics We Cover in This Episode:

  • The difference between yoga therapy and traditional yoga classes
  • How your body holds onto emotional pain and how to begin releasing it
  • A surprising perspective on how social media impacts community and connection
  • The role of the “inner witness” in self-awareness and healing

In this conversation, I explore the complexities of people pleasing, highlighting its roots as a defense mechanism that often stems from early relational experiences. I discuss how people pleasing can inhibit connections and lead to emotional detachment in our most important relationships. The conversation emphasizes the importance of self-connection and open communication in repairing relationships and addressing emotional needs. I discuss: Where people pleasing comes from What we loose out on from people pleasing How people pleasers show up differently in low stakes and high stakes relationships Repairing relationships takes time and requires self-awareness. Our relationships suffer when needs are not expressed. Emotional needs do not disappear; they resurface in different ways. Understanding oneself is the first step to addressing people pleasing.
